Purpose: The purpose of this study was to investigate characteristics of chorioretinal lesions secondary to acute posterior multifocal placoid pigment epitheliopathy (APMPPE) using multi-wavelength fundus autofluorescence (FAF) and their association with intraocular inflammation.

Methods: In this exploratory cross-sectional study, patients with chorioretinal lesions secondary to APMPPE underwent multimodal imaging including FAF with 450 nm, 488 nm, 518 nm, and 787 nm excitation wavelength, color fundus photography (CFP), and optical coherence tomography (OCT). Lesions were graded for FAF and CFP characteristics and inflammatory activity by an experienced image grader and an ophthalmologist.

Uveitis diseases are generally rare and therefore often pose a significant challenge in treatment. In developed countries, non-infectious uveitis is one of the most common causes of severe functional impairment and even blindness. The current guidelines provide information on when and how to initiate treatment, but do not include recommendations on when and how to reduce or discontinue treatment.

This longitudinal study examined how active gastrointestinal (GI) cancer types affect immune responses to SARS-CoV-2, focusing on the ability to neutralize the Omicron variants. Patients with GI cancer ( = 168) were categorized into those with hepatocellular carcinoma, hepatic metastatic GI cancer, non-hepatic metastatic GI cancer, and two control groups of patients with and without underlying liver diseases. Humoral and cellular immune responses were evaluated before and after Omicron antigen exposures.

Background: Conditional logistic regression trees have been proposed as a flexible alternative to the standard method of conditional logistic regression for the analysis of matched case-control studies. While they allow to avoid the strict assumption of linearity and automatically incorporate interactions, conditional logistic regression trees may suffer from a relatively high variability. Further machine learning methods for the analysis of matched case-control studies are missing because conventional machine learning methods cannot handle the matched structure of the data.

Article Synopsis
  • Macular Telangiectasia Type 2 (MacTel) is a chronic eye disease affecting the central retina, currently lacking effective treatment, highlighting the need for biomarkers to identify patients at risk for disease progression.
  • Research compared stable and progressive forms of MacTel using advanced imaging techniques like optical coherence tomography (OCT) and found distinct differences in vessel density between the two groups.
  • The study identifies superficial retinal layer skeleton density, baseline visual acuity, and ellipsoid zone loss as potential predictive biomarkers for disease progression, suggesting they could help in clinical trials for MacTel.

This paper presents a semi-parametric modeling technique for estimating the survival function from a set of right-censored time-to-event data. Our method, named pseudo-value regression trees (PRT), is based on the pseudo-value regression framework, modeling individual-specific survival probabilities by computing pseudo-values and relating them to a set of covariates. The standard approach to pseudo-value regression is to fit a main-effects model using generalized estimating equations (GEE).

As most rare diseases, intermediate uveitis lacks reliable endpoints necessary for randomized clinical trials. Therefore, we investigated longitudinal changes of retinal and choriocapillaris perfusion on optical coherence tomography angiography (OCT-A) in intermediate uveitis and their prognostic value for future best corrected visual acuity (BCVA) and central retinal thickness (CRT). In this retrospective, longitudinal cohort study eyes of patients with intermediate uveitis were imaged by swept-source OCT-A (macula-centered 3 × 3 mm; PLEX Elite 9000, Zeiss) and stratified into clinically stable, worsened and improved based on changes in clinical parameters.

Introduction: Dizziness is a common symptom with diverse causes, including ear-nose-throat, internal, neurological, or psychiatric origins. While for most parts treatable in nonemergency settings, it can also signal time-critical conditions, like an unnoticed stroke, requiring prompt diagnosis and treatment to prevent lasting harm or death. The aim of this study was to evaluate the validity of the Manchester Triage System in classifying patients presenting with dizziness based on final diagnoses and patient outcomes, as no specific flow chart exists for this symptom in the MTS.

Neuroinflammation is a hallmark of Alzheimer's disease (AD) and both positive and negative associations of individual inflammation-related markers with brain structure and cognitive function have been described. We aimed to identify inflammatory signatures of CSF immune-related markers that relate to changes of brain structure and cognition across the clinical spectrum ranging from normal aging to AD. A panel of 16 inflammatory markers, Aβ42/40 and p-tau181 were measured in CSF at baseline in the DZNE DELCODE cohort (n = 295); a longitudinal observational study focusing on at-risk stages of AD.
